Abstract

A method and apparatus for detecting winding errors in electric motor stators having a plurality of field windings is disclosed. The method involves the steps of applying a current source to at least one of the field windings to generate a magnetic field within the stator, measuring the polarity and strength of the field for each winding at preselected radial and angular positions about a circumference of the stator bore, and comparing the measured values to recorded values of radially and angularly corresponding measurements for a reference motor stator. Preferably, the current source is applied to each of the windings in succession. The apparatus includes a terminal block, switch, and power supply to connect a source of current to each field winding in succession to generate a magnetic field within the stator. In one embodiment, the apparatus includes a magnetic sensor mounted at a predetermined radial position for rotation on a shaft, and an encoder proximate the shaft to determine the angular position of the shaft. In a second embodiment, the apparatus includes a plurality of magnetic sensors mounted at preselected radial and angular positions about an arbor or drum sized to fit within the stator. Both embodiments include means for comparing the measured magnetic field values to recorded values of radially and angularly corresponding measurements for a reference motor stator.
